using Vector = System.Collections.Generic.IReadOnlyList<double>;
namespace Colourful.Implementation.Conversion
{
/// <summary>
/// Converts from <see cref="RGBColor" /> to <see cref="LinearRGBColor" />.
/// </summary>
public sealed class RGBToLinearRGBConverter : IColorConversion<RGBColor, LinearRGBColor>
{
/// <summary>
/// Default singleton instance of the converter.
/// </summary>
public static readonly RGBToLinearRGBConverter Default = new RGBToLinearRGBConverter();
/// <summary>
/// Converts from <see cref="RGBColor" /> to <see cref="LinearRGBColor" />.
/// </summary>
public LinearRGBColor Convert(in RGBColor input)
{
var uncompandedVector = UncompandVector(input);
var converted = new LinearRGBColor(uncompandedVector, input.WorkingSpace);
return converted;
}
/// <summary>
/// Applying the working space inverse companding function (<see cref="IRGBWorkingSpace.Companding" />) to RGB vector.
/// </summary>
private static Vector UncompandVector(in RGBColor rgbColor)
{
var companding = rgbColor.WorkingSpace.Companding;
var compandedVector = rgbColor.Vector;
Vector uncompandedVector = new[]
{
companding.InverseCompanding(compandedVector[0]).CropRange(0, 1),
companding.InverseCompanding(compandedVector[1]).CropRange(0, 1),
companding.InverseCompanding(compandedVector[2]).CropRange(0, 1)
};
return uncompandedVector;
}
#region Overrides
/// <inheritdoc cref="object" />
public bool Equals(RGBToLinearRGBConverter other) => other != null;
/// <inheritdoc cref="object" />
public override bool Equals(object obj) => obj is RGBToLinearRGBConverter;
/// <inheritdoc cref="object" />
public override int GetHashCode() => 1;
/// <inheritdoc cref="object" />
public static bool operator ==(RGBToLinearRGBConverter left, RGBToLinearRGBConverter right) => Equals(left, right);
/// <inheritdoc cref="object" />
public static bool operator !=(RGBToLinearRGBConverter left, RGBToLinearRGBConverter right) => !Equals(left, right);
#endregion
}
}
